Definisi 니켈촉매 dalam kamus Kreol Haiti
Pemangkin nikel Ia adalah pemangkin yang paling banyak digunakan untuk hidrogenasi am. Terdapat juga pemangkin penstabilan yang stabil oleh penjerapan karbon dioksida selepas pengurangan atau pembangunan, dan digunakan sebagai pemangkin untuk pelbagai hidrokrak pada suhu tinggi dan boleh ditambah kepada komponen pemangkin hidrodesulfurization.
